The idea of the national lampoon rose out of another brand, the harvard lampoon, the college publication that, since its inception in 1876, lived to mock everything and everyone especially harvards snooty trappings and the stuffiness of the official university paper, the crimson. National lampoon was an american humor magazine which ran from 1970 to 1998. Founders kenney, henry beard and rob hoffman honed their chops aping playboy, life and time at the harvard. National lampoon magazine reached its height of popularity and critical acclaim during the 1970s, when it had a farreaching effect on american humor and comedy.
